#03e935 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#03e935 is composed of 1.2% red, 91.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 133 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 46.3%. #03e935 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ff6a with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#03e935 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#03e935 has RGB values of R:3, G:233,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 256309.

Hex triplet 03e935 #03e935
RGB Decimal 3, 233, 53 rgb(3,233,53)
RGB Percent 1.2, 91.4, 20.8 rgb(1.2%,91.4%,20.8%)
CMYK 99, 0, 77, 9
HSL 133°, 97.5, 46.3 hsl(133,97.5%,46.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 133°, 98.7, 91.4
Web Safe 00ff33 #00ff33
CIE-LAB 81.044, -78.554, 68.589
XYZ 29.817, 58.551, 13.098
xyY 0.294, 0.577, 58.551
CIE-LCH 81.044, 104.284, 138.874
CIE-LUV 81.044, -75.8, 92.602
Hunter-Lab 76.518, -64.351, 43.414
Binary 00000011, 11101001, 00110101

Shades and Tints of #03e935

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#ecfff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#03e935

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707c73 is the less saturated color, while #03e935 is the most saturated one.
